Congress is looking for ways to make sure foreign contractors follow U.S. laws and regulations. Just last week the Senate Homeland Security and Governmental Affairs Committee approved a bill that will require foreign companies working on government contracts to consent to personal jurisdiction in the U.S. Federal courts for civil action or criminal prosecution related to alleged wrongdoing in connection with the contracts.
